Scarecrow winners in Ordsall

ORDSALL father and son Gary and Adam Peel scooped first prize at the village's annual scarecrow competition after sculpting this masterpiece.

The Peels, of Wollaton Rise Ordsall, created the scary crow out of chicken wire, bits of gazebo, pipe insulation and black bin bags.

The feet were made from a pair of old diving flippers while the eyes are made from a tennis ball and the beak is an empty squash bottle.

The trophy, an original pitch fork, will be passed on to the winner of the next scarecrow festival but Gary and Adam were also given a decorated pot and daffodil bulbs to keep.

This year's Ordsall Scarecrow Competition raised more than 200 for the village hall fund.
